in 2018 as a professor and Canada 150 Chair. Her research includes the evolution of sex chromosomes and the genetics underlying sex differences. Her work has revealed fundamental properties of the earliest stages of Y chromosomes formation. Mank makes use of genomic data to understand how ecological factors effect genome evolution, and how sex differences are encoded within the genome. She has studied the genetics of female mate preference in guppies, and how this affects the diversity and genetics of pigmentation in males.
